PROLIFIC NOVELIST
Woman Surpassing Edgar Wallace. , London, February T 3. Writing at the rate of a million words a year, Miss Maysie Greig, the novelist, is now surpassing Edgar Wallace for output. Just over 30, she has aready 30 publitued books to her credA, and her pen becomes more prolific. In the last year she has written six novels, the latest of winch “New Moon Through a Window,” will shortly be issued. “Mott of her actual Writing is done at her charming country residence—- | a modernised Tudor house near Andover,” her secretary told an ihterv.iewer this week. “She keeps a strict timetable, working from ten in the morning till six in the evening. 57he speed of her composition is amazing.” Mits Greig always writes love stories. “I write happy love stories because I believe that happiness is the greatest virtue in the world anil misery the greatest sin,” she says.
